How to choose high-quality coffee beans: Experts teach you how to buy good coffee

Coffee is a must-have drink for many people in the morning, but how to choose high-quality coffee beans is a headache. In this article, we will focus on experts teaching you how to choose good coffee and introduce you to some key points for choosing high-quality coffee beans.

First, observe the appearance. High-quality coffee beans usually have a smooth and uniform surface and a relatively uniform color. If you find any irregularities or obvious discoloration (such as black spots), it is likely caused by poor storage or processing. In addition, when choosing, you can gently pinch a bean. If you feel that the hardness is moderate and there is no obvious crispness, it means that it is fresh.

Next, smell the aroma. Good coffee beans should have a strong and aromatic aroma. When you open the bag, pay attention to whether you can smell a strong and tempting aroma. In addition, during the selection process, you can also try to crush some beans and bring them close to your nose to smell them so that you can better feel their aroma. If the coffee beans exude a strong aroma such as chocolate, nuts or fruits, it means that they are of high quality.


Finally, understand the origin and roasting degree. Different origins and roasting degrees will bring different flavor characteristics to coffee beans. Generally speaking, coffee beans from a single origin are more likely to show specific flavor characteristics, while blended beans may have a more complex and balanced taste. In addition, the roasting degree will also have an important impact on the taste of coffee. Light roasting usually allows the coffee to retain more original flavor and has a higher acidity; medium roasting often brings a balanced and smooth taste; and deep roasting often makes the coffee have a strong and bitter taste.


In short, when choosing high-quality coffee beans, we can start from observing the appearance, smelling the aroma, and understanding the origin and roasting degree. Through these methods, we can better choose coffee beans that suit our taste and have good quality, adding more fun to our coffee experience.
